About T.J. Miller

T.J. MILLER is a comedian.

You may recognize him from roles in Deadpool, Transformers 4, and Mike Judge’s Silicon Valley, for which he received the Critics’ Choice Award for Best Supporting Actor in a TV Comedy.

Miller has been in over 25 major studio films including Office Christmas Party, Cloverfield, She's Out of My League, Ready Player One, Extract, Our Idiot Brother, Yogi Bear 3D (Ranger Jones, his greatest role to date), Unstoppable, Underwater, and Get Him to the Greek.

His voice is possibly more famous than him- from television roles in Family Guy, F is for Family, High School USA!, Gravity Falls, among others… Miller also voiced the character Tuffnut in the Oscar-nominated animated film How to Train Your Dragon, and How to Train Your Dragon 2. Miller voiced Fred in Disney’s Academy Award-winning Big Hero 6.

But let’s be honest. Everyone knows him because he’s the star of The Emoji Movie.
